Abstract

The present invention relates to an isolated COP1 nucleic acid sequence from a maize plant and the isolated COP1 nucleic acid sequence is named as ZmCOP1. The present invention also relates to a method of using the ZmCOP1 nucleic acid sequence to control the shade avoidance response of a crop plant for high density farming and yield enhancement.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. A recombinant DNA construct comprising a COP1 nucleotide sequence encoding a polypeptide having an amino acid sequence that has at least 90% sequence identity to SEQ ID NO: 21, said COP1 nucleotide sequence being operably linked upstream (5′) to a heterologous promoter that functions in a plant and downstream (3′) to a regulatory element, wherein the polypeptide binds to a COP1 protein. 
     
     
       2. A crop plant comprising the recombinant DNA construct of  claim 1 . 
     
     
       3. Progeny or seeds comprising the recombinant DNA construct of  claim 1 . 
     
     
       4. The recombinant DNA construct of  claim 1 , wherein said promoter comprises a light-inducible promoter. 
     
     
       5. The recombinant DNA construct of  claim 4 , wherein said promoter is selected from the group consisting of a cab promoter, an ATHB-2 promoter, and a far red light inducible promoter. 
     
     
       6. The recombinant DNA construct of  claim 4 , wherein said promoter comprises a cab promoter. 
     
     
       7. The recombinant DNA construct of  claim 1 , wherein said regulatory element comprises an intron. 
     
     
       8. The recombinant DNA construct of  claim 7 , wherein said intron comprises a hsp70 intron. 
     
     
       9. The recombinant DNA construct of  claim 1 , wherein said COP1 nucleotide sequence is isolated from a monocot plant. 
     
     
       10. The recombinant DNA construct of  claim 9 , wherein said COP1 nucleotide sequence is isolated from a rice maize plant.
